Mark Webber will debut Red Bull’s new challenger on the opening day of the first pre-season test in Jerez, according to a report.

Germany’s Auto Motor und Sport claims the Australian will be behind the wheel of the RB8 on February 7 and 8 with team-mate Sebastian Vettel taking over for the final two days.

The report adds that World Champion Vettel gets the first two days “off” so that he doesn’t have to deal with any teething problems.

McLaren, Ferrari and Sauber are the other teams who have confirmed that their new cars will debut in the south of Spain in early February.

Mercedes, meanwhile, have revealed that they will skip the Jerez test entirely and will unveil their new car ahead of the the second pre-season test at Barcelona.
